I've just got a simple excel file that i throw the number of litres purchased, distance traveled since last fill, and cost, and from there a couple of simple forumla's take care of the calculations to spit out litres per 100 km's (which is distance traveled over litres used times 100)
If you wanted to be really fancy about it you could create the graphs that give you a visual of how your consumption fares
